[おや()·こう()·こう()]
oyakoukou
noun, suru verb, na adjective

English Meaning(s) for 親孝行

noun, suru verb, na adjective
  1. filial piety; being kind to one's parents; taking care of one's parents

Meanings for each kanji in 親孝行

» parent; intimacy; relative; familiarity; dealer (cards)
» filial piety; child's respect
» going; journey
